Who is Ute Wetzig?
Ute Wetzig is a female diver from Germany, who won a gold, a silver and a bronze medal in the women's 10 m platform event at the European Championships in the early 1990s.
Wetzig competed for her native country in three consecutive Summer Olympics, starting in 1992. She was affiliated with the BSV AOK Leipzig during her career.
